Guest ssschmidt Posted November 7, 2007 Report Posted November 7, 2007 Thanks Lozzd. Is there any specific reason for this? It would be good to have things such as Birthdays show up a few days in advance in order to remind me to buy a prezzie ;) I think that is just the way it was designed. You can always set up a reminder for the item and put the reminder a couple of days in advance, or get PocketBreeze which has a special events tab that will allow you to display anniversaries, birthdays, and 4 additional categories in the time frame you select.
